A standard company profile should be between two and four pages long. This provides enough space to showcase your services, safety credentials, and key projects without overwhelming a busy property manager or procurement officer.
A capability statement is a highly targeted, one-page document designed specifically for government or large commercial bids. A company profile is a more comprehensive booklet or PDF used for general marketing, website integration, and client onboarding.
You should exclude specific pricing or hourly rates from your profile, as material costs and project scopes fluctuate constantly. Instead, focus on your billing structure, estimation process, and the types of contract models you accept, such as fixed-fee or time-and-materials.
You should update your company profile annually to reflect your latest completed projects, renewed licenses, and current insurance limits. If your team undergoes major expansions or adds new specialized service certifications, update the document immediately.
